By 1951 the Japanese had produced the first military truck, the Toyota Jeep BJ, predecessor to the Land Cruiser. Willy's, who had a claim to the Jeep monicker, sued almost immediately and Toyota changed the name to Land Cruiser. Agile, quick, and indestructible, it became the official patrol car for the Japanese National Police Agency.

The Toyota War (Arabic: حرب التويوتا, romanized: Ḥarb al-Tūyūtā, Harb-el-Touyouta, French: Guerre des Toyota), also known as the Great Toyota War, [9] which took place in 1987 in Northern Chad and on the Chad-Libya border, was the last phase of the Chadian-Libyan War. It takes its name from the Toyota pickup trucks, primarily the Toyota Hilux and the Toyota Land Cruiser.

The war earned its name from the extensive use of Toyota pickup trucks-specifically the Toyota Hilux and Toyota Land Cruiser-by Chadian forces. These vehicles, known as technicals, provided exceptional mobility and versatility, enabling Chadian troops to conduct rapid and effective operations against the Libyan military.
